Mobile Module Transmitters

Mobile Modules are portable transmitters that send data from your gage(s) to the computer wirelessly, with the push of a button. A typical wireless system contains a Base (receiver) and anywhere from one to hundreds of Mobile Modules (transmitters).

About Mobile Module Transmitters

MobileCollect supports a broader range of gages than any other wireless system.  These include handheld gages from manufacturers such as Brown & Sharpe, CDI, Fowler, INSIZE, LMI, Mahr Federal, Mettler-Toledo, Mitutoyo, Ohaus, Ono Sokki,  Starrett, Sylvac, etc.

Because of the number and variety of gage cables supported by MobileCollect, a gage cable is not included with the Mobile Module.  You must order the appropriate gage cable separately.  A few of the common gage cables are listed on our MobileCollect Wireless Store.  Refer to the MobileCollect Selection Tool page for additional cable information.

MobileCollect gives you the greatest range of options and flexibility for configuring your wireless measurement collection.

MobileCollect supports a wide range of digital gages and RS-232 devices from manufacturers including Mitutoyo, Mahr Federal, Ono Sokki, Fowler, INSIZE, Starrett, Sylvac, Ohaus, Mettler Toledo, etc. and our own GageWay line of interfaces.

MobileCollect has been approved for use in North America, South America, Australia, New Zealand and Europe.  The radios used in MobileCollect operate in the Industrial, Scientific & Medical (ISM) frequency band at 2.4 GHz.
